Port Jefferson Fire Department at the Port Jefferson Free Library!

It has been 125 years since the formation of the Port Jefferson Fire Department. Officially established on March 1, 1887, the first fire house was located on Main Street in what is now Z-Pita Restaurant. The Fire Department has come a long way from horse drawn fire trucks and they are happy to share their history with the library and our patrons.

From a model of the department’s first fire house, created by ex-chief Robert Collins, to a plaque depicting the history of the 1913 fire that destroyed the original Port Jefferson High School; the Fire Department has brought their best items to put on display.

To view these artifacts and more, just stop by the library anytime. The display case is located adjacent to the Adult Reference desk.
